Transaction 38396ee89467a82b3754fab53e9f4e5eaabd66bfbf950df087e2061bfd96aa8a
1 Input
1 Output
-
38396ee89467a82b3754fab53e9f4e5eaabd66bfbf950df087e2061bfd96aa8a:0
- value
- 579986
- script pubkey
- OP_0 OP_PUSHBYTES_20 85ee46eb49146d3052cd546172c135e7ce89b7a3
- address
- bc1qshhyd66fz3knq5kd23sh9sf4ul8gndarcj7z86